Here's a few of my current setups.
The first two are of my 150-gal SA community, which has about 12 young Geophagus redhead "Tapajos" that I'm growing out, and a single wild caught leopoldi angelfish, along with a pair of Bolivian rams, rosy and Bentosi tetras, black neon tetras and a couple of rasboras. There are also some BN plecos. I've got some newly acquired wild cross angel babies in another tank that will go in with the single angel as soon as they get a bit bigger.
This is my brackish 20-long with Otis, the F8 puffer (he's barely visible coming out of his cave) He's tricky to get good pics of.
This is a 45-gal that I just planted the other day, now that I've decided to turn it into an angel display tank. I'll grow out the 11 wild crosses that are in there now (about nickel sized) and leave a pair in this tank (along with a pair of Bolivian rams, rosy tetras and a BN pleco) after I move the others to the 150 and elsewhere.
